Chris Ofili — Poolside Magic 5
Chris Ofili

Poolside Magic 5

2012

This mixed media work on paper presents a vertically oriented composition dominated by warm yellows and earth tones, punctuated by cooler blues and greens. A standing figure in blue, adorned with a green bow, gazes downward toward a reclining nude form rendered in ochres and browns, whose voluptuous contours are emphasized through bold charcoal drawing. The background features a cloud like form against a luminous yellow sky, while the lower register grounds the scene in abstracted architectural or spatial elements. Executed in charcoal, watercolor, and pastel, the work demonstrates the artist's characteristic layering of figuration with gestural abstraction, drawing on traditions of modernist figuration while engaging with contemporary explorations of desire, the body, and representation.
